# Sharding notes for the support crew:
# The Pellgrove profile store is now split across four shards,
# keyed on account region. If a user complains their profile
# looks stale, check which shard they hash to before escalating.
# The lookup tool needs direct read access — when prompted,
# connect to the shard-map database using the connection string below.

replica DSN, kajep-yahag: mssql://praok_svc:iF@db-8d68.plorvaio.local:5432/eliion

HANDOVER — Tovren upload pipeline

Encoding detection for uploaded text files now uses the Skarn sniffer first, falling back to byte-histogram heuristics. UTF-16 without BOM still misfires on short files under 200 bytes; workaround is forcing Latin-1 and logging a warning. Test fixtures live in the Quillden repo. Release gate: do not ship until the fixture suite passes twice consecutively. To unlock the staging credentials vault for the final smoke run, use the recovery passphrase below.

strongbox words: praath-queniel-holax-druael-jorath-noveth-druok

### Action Item: Spoolhaven Retry Storm

From last Tuesday's outage: the Spoolhaven print service retried failed jobs without backoff, saturating the render pool. Fix merged; retries now use capped exponential backoff with jitter. Owner will monitor for a week before closing. The agreed retry constants are recorded below.

constants for yadup-kajof:
RATE_LIMITS = {
    "zorwyn": 1,
    "druwyn": 1,
}